Pharmaceutical companies, like Pfizer, are venturing into digital healthcare platforms, raising questions about competition with traditional pharmacies. Pfizer recently announced its initiative, "Pfizer for All," a digital platform that offers services such as vaccine scheduling and potential savings on medications, possibly bypassing pharmacy benefit managers (PBMs). This platform supports patients with private and government insurance, but there are concerns about how it addresses those without insurance.
The platform also enables same-day telehealth appointments with independent providers, which may raise regulatory concerns, particularly around kickbacks, given the scrutiny telehealth has faced from authorities like the DOJ and FDA. Pharmacists are encouraged to consider how this could impact their practice and whether patients might prefer these new options. The dialogue continues about the potential shift in pharmacy dynamics as digital platforms gain traction.
